Morning Clarity Rituals That Guide Every Choice

Begin before noise arrives. A brief journal, a minute of negative visualization, and a single intention for money and mood align actions with values. By rehearsing obstacles and precommitting to behaviors, you reduce friction, protect attention, and let calm priorities, not impulses, choose for you. Write three lines: what is within your control today, one person to thank, and one financial action you will complete. Imagine the day going wrong: an unexpected bill, a frustrating client, a tempting flash sale. Rehearse graceful responses now—buffer funds, a polite pause phrase, and a default cooling‑off delay. Decisions Under Uncertainty, Calmly and Quantitatively

Stoic calm pairs beautifully with expected‑value thinking. Separate what you control, estimate ranges rather than certainties, and make small reversible moves when outcomes are foggy. Stacking Skills Sprint

Pick one thirty‑day sprint to add a high‑leverage skill—spreadsheets, negotiation, copywriting, or basic analytics. Fifteen focused minutes daily compounds shockingly. Combine with your existing strengths to create rare intersections. At month’s end, ship a tiny project that proves competence. The Stoic Postmortem

After losses, write a calm debrief: what happened, where agency existed, and what precommitment will prevent repeats. Skip blame. Seek mechanisms. Archive lessons where future you will see them before similar choices. Asymmetric Upside Habits

Favor choices with capped downside and open upside: writing daily online, asking one bold question, or testing micro‑products. Most attempts gently fail; a few meaningfully change income or opportunity. Track attempts, not outcomes.
